[MPlayer-users] Fullscreen problem with xv/x11 output

Sala Riccardo sala.rky at tiscali.it
Mon Nov 18 18:37:02 CET 2002


Karim Belbachir wrote:

>Hi,
>
>I get a crash every time I run MPlayer in fullscreen mode (the -fs option) with the xv/x11/xvidix video output. This bug seems to exist since the 0.90pre5 release or so. The bug doesn't occur with the following command lines:
># mplayer -vo dga ../theThing.avi
>$ mplayer -fs -vo sdl ../theThing.avi
>$ mplayer -xy 1024 -vo xv ../theThing.avi # fullscreen 
>
>Command:
>
>$ ./mplayer -v -vo xv -fs ../theThing.avi > mplayer.log 2>&1
>
>System Info:
>
>Slackware 8.0
>Kernel 2.4.19
>XFree 4.1.0
>libc 2.2.3
>gcc 2.95.3
>ld & as 2.11.90.0.19
>fvwm 2.4.0
>
>Hardware & drivers:
>
>processor       : 0
>vendor_id       : AuthenticAMD
>cpu family      : 6
>model           : 4
>model name      : AMD Athlon(tm) processor
>stepping        : 4
>cpu MHz         : 1195.251
>cache size      : 256 KB
>fdiv_bug        : no
>hlt_bug         : no
>f00f_bug        : no
>coma_bug        : no
>fpu             : yes
>fpu_exception   : yes
>cpuid level     : 1
>wp              : yes
>flags           : fpu v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ca cmov pat pse36 mmx fxsr syscall mmxext 3dnowext 3dnow
>bogomips        : 2385.51
>
>My graphic card is a ATI Rage 128 Pro 32 Mb
>The X driver is r128_drv.o
>
>Misc:
>
>Here is the definition of my 320x240 mode in the XF86Config file:
>Modeline    "320x240"  12.588 320 336 384 400  240 245 246 262 Doublescan
>gdb log: ftp://mplayerhq.hu/MPlayer/incoming/gdb-xv.log
>
>  
>
>------------------------------------------------------------------------
>
>Using GNU internationalization
>Original domain: messages
>Original dirname: /usr/share/locale
>Current domain: mplayer
>Current dirname: /usr/local/share/locale
>
>
>MPlayer CVS-021117-06:00-2.95.3 (C) 2000-2002 Arpad Gereoffy (see DOCS)
>
>CPU: Advanced Micro Devices Athlon TB Thunderbird (Family: 6, Stepping: 4)
>CPUflags:  MMX: 1 MMX2: 1 3DNow: 1 3DNow2: 1 SSE: 0 SSE2: 0
>Compiled for x86 CPU with extensions: MMX MMX2 3DNow 3DNowEx
>
>/home/karim/.mplayer/config(11): option: vo
>/home/karim/.mplayer/config(11): parameter: sdl,xv
>/home/karim/.mplayer/config(14): option: ao
>/home/karim/.mplayer/config(14): parameter: oss
>/home/karim/.mplayer/config(17): option: fs
>/home/karim/.mplayer/config(17): parameter: no
>/home/karim/.mplayer/config(38): option: zoom
>/home/karim/.mplayer/config(38): parameter: yes
>/home/karim/.mplayer/config(127): option: framedrop
>/home/karim/.mplayer/config(127): parameter: no
>/home/karim/.mplayer/config(130): option: vfm
>/home/karim/.mplayer/config(130): parameter: ffmpeg
>/home/karim/.mplayer/config(134): option: afm
>/home/karim/.mplayer/config(134): parameter: libmad
>/home/karim/.mplayer/config(136): option: osdlevel
>/home/karim/.mplayer/config(136): parameter: 1
>/home/karim/.mplayer/config(138): option: pp
>/home/karim/.mplayer/config(138): parameter: 0x20000
>Reading /home/karim/.mplayer/codecs.conf: can't open '/home/karim/.mplayer/codecs.conf': No such file or directory
>Reading /usr/local/etc/mplayer/codecs.conf: 38 audio & 110 video codecs
>CommandLine: '-v' '-vo' 'xv' '-fs' '../theThing.avi'
>get_path('font/font.desc') -> '/home/karim/.mplayer/font/font.desc'
>font: can't open file: /home/karim/.mplayer/font/font.desc
>Font /usr/local/share/mplayer/font/font.desc loaded successfully! (206 chars)
>Using MMX (with tiny bit MMX2) Optimized OnScreenDisplay
>Using usleep() timing
>get_path('input.conf') -> '/home/karim/.mplayer/input.conf'
>Can't open input config file /home/karim/.mplayer/input.conf : No such file or directory
>Can't open input config file /usr/local/etc/mplayer/input.conf : No such file or directory
>Falling back on default (hardcoded) input config
>
>Playing ../theThing.avi
>Not an URL!
>File size is 5413268 bytes
>Detected AVI file format!
>list_end=0x138
>======= AVI Header =======
>us/frame: 66666  (fps=15.000)
>max bytes/sec: 0
>padding: 0
>MainAVIHeader.dwFlags: (16) HAS_INDEX
>frames  total: 524   initial: 11
>streams: 2
>Suggested BufferSize: 0
>Size:  320 x 240
>list_end=0xD4
>==> Found video stream: 0
>======= STREAM Header =======
>Type: vids   FCC: cvid (64697663)
>Flags: 0
>Priority: 0   Language: 0
>InitialFrames: 0
>Rate: 600/40 = 15.000
>Start: 0   Len: 491
>Suggested BufferSize: 20228
>Quality 10000
>Sample size: 0
>found 'bih', 40 bytes of 40
>======= VIDEO Format ======
>  biSize 40
>  biWidth 320
>  biHeight 240
>  biPlanes 1
>  biBitCount 24
>  biCompression 1684633187='cvid'
>  biSizeImage 0
>===========================
>list_end=0x138
>==> Found audio stream: 1
>======= STREAM Header =======
>Type: auds   FCC:  (0)
>Flags: 0
>Priority: 0   Language: 0
>InitialFrames: 11
>Rate: 22050/1 = 22050.000
>Start: 0   Len: 721733
>Suggested BufferSize: 44100
>Quality 10000
>Sample size: 2
>found 'wf', 16 bytes of 18
>======= WAVE Format =======
>Format Tag: 1 (0x1)
>Channels: 1
>Samplerate: 22050
>avg byte/sec: 44100
>Block align: 2
>bits/sample: 16
>cbSize: 0
>Broken chunk?  chunksize=1716  (id=JUNK)
>list_end=0x5278CC
>Found movie at 0x800 - 0x5278CC
>Reading INDEX block, 524 chunks for 524 frames (fpos=0x5278d4)
>AVI index offset: 0x7FC (movi=0x800 idx0=0x4 idx1=0xAC50)
>Auto-selected AVI audio ID = 1
>Auto-selected AVI video ID = 0
>AVI: Searching for audio stream (id:1)
>AVI video length=4676911
>VIDEO:  [cvid]  320x240  24bpp  15.00 fps  1143.0 kbps (139.5 kbyte/s)
>[V] filefmt:3  fourcc:0x64697663  size:320x240  fps:15.00  ftime:=0.0667
>get_path('sub/') -> '/home/karim/.mplayer/sub/'
>==========================================================================
>Trying to force audio codec driver family libmad ...
>Opening audio decoder: [pcm] Uncompressed PCM audio decoder
>dec_audio: Allocating 2048 + 65536 = 67584 bytes for output buffer
>AUDIO: 22050 Hz, 1 ch, 16 bit (0x10), ratio: 44100->44100 (352.8 kbit)
>Selected audio codec: [pcm] afm:pcm (Uncompressed PCM)
>==========================================================================
>X11 opening display: :0.0
>vo: X11 color mask:  FFFFFF  (R:FF0000 G:FF00 B:FF)
>vo: X11 running at 1024x768 with depth 24 and 32 bpp (":0.0" => local display)
>[x11] Create window for WM detect ...
>[x11] Unknown wm type...
>Xv: could not grab port 50
>Could not find free Xvideo port - maybe another process is already using it.
>Close all video applications, and try again. If that does not help,
>see 'mplayer -vo help' for other (non-xv) video out drivers.
>Error opening/initializing the selected video_out (-vo) device!
>
>uninit audio: pcm  
>DEMUXER: freeing demuxer at 0x82659c8  
>vo: uninit ...
>
>Exiting... (End of file)
>  
>
Try gaos driver.
bye.





More information about the MPlayer-users mailing list